Wagering Requirements Explained (No Fluff)

Let me break down the maths because this is where most no deposit bonuses fail. You get 20 free spins. You win, say, £10 from those spins. That £10 is not yours yet. You have to wager it 40 times. That means you need to place bets totalling £400 (40 x £10) before you can withdraw anything.

That sounds steep, I know. But here is the reality check. Most no deposit bonuses have wagering between 35x and 60x. 40x is in the middle. It is not the best, but it is not the worst. The trick is to play low-volatility slots to grind through the wagering without losing your balance too fast. Do not go chasing big jackpots with this bonus. Play safe. Games like ‘Starburst’ or ‘Blood Suckers’ are good choices because they have high RTP and low variance.

Also, check the game restrictions. Some games contribute less to wagering. For example, table games like blackjack might only count 10% towards the wagering. Slots usually count 100%. Stick to slots.
